Battery Issues

The battery of a key fob can easily become drained in the event that it is not replaced in time. The key fob won't be able to communicate with your vehicle. This is a problem if you want to use the key fob to open doors or push button to start the engine. Luckily, changing the battery in the majority of modern key fobs is simple. It is crucial to make sure you are using the correct type of battery (a multimeter can be helpful here). A CR2032 is a standard size used in most key fobs, but it is always best to read the owner's manual, or go online for the correct battery for your. Once you have the new battery, it's an excellent idea to test it to determine whether the fob responds properly.

If you find that you need to click the key fob's button several times before it locks and unlocks, the battery is low. It is recommended to replace it as soon as you can. A damaged battery could cause the key fob to lose memory and cease to respond to a press even if it is a new replacement.

Another sign that it's time to change your key fob battery is when you must hold your key fob close to the car for it to unlock. A working key fob usually operates at a distance of approximately 20 feet, whereas the dead one will only work at close range.

You can try a few things yourself to fix your key fob before calling an expert. First, replace the batteries. Most fobs come with one battery and you can get the replacement for around $10 or less. They are available in the majority of hardware stores and big-box retailers, or online. Check your owner's guide or go online to find out what kind of battery your key fob requires.

Another possible fix is to open up the fob and inspect it for indications of damage. Some of these might include cracks in the circuit board, tiny electronic components that aren't fully connected to the board, or buttons that are missing or not in the right place. The range of a key fob is another common problem. If you notice that your car needs to be in close proximity to the key fob to unlock or start it, this can be a sign that the battery is depleted. This could also be the case when you need to press the button multiple times before the car starts up.

If changing the batteries does not solve the issue then you may want to take your key fob apart to conduct a visual inspection. The battery connector's terminals may occasionally break, so checking them and carefully soldering them back into place could assist in getting your key working properly. You can also adjust any buttons that appear to be broken or stuck, but this will usually require professional attention.
